Eight arrested as illegal casino is shut down by police in Pennsylvania

0

Eight people were arrested last month in Pennsylvania after an illegal casino was found by police officers, authorities have stated in a social media post.

On January 28, officers from Lancaster Station’s Community Appreciation Team managed to target an illegal casino operation that was located in the west 300 block of Avenue J-2 after securing a search warrant.

As a result, eight people were arrested, five illegal gambling machines were seized, four felony arrests that included two with outstanding robbery warrants and a further four misdemeanour arrests relating to illegal gambling activity.

Dubbed as “tap-taps”, these illegal operations are often located behind fictitious storefronts which don’t have a business license.

As such, they often become focal points for drug use, shootings and other criminal activity, creating havoc in surrounding neighbourhoods.

 Despite this illegal operation being seized, crime actually decreased in 2025.

Homicide rates have decreased in Lancaster County over the previous 12 months

According to county commissioner Josh Parsons, the rate of crime decreased throughout 2025 in the area.

“Well, that’s the number one job of government is public safety,” Parsons said. “We take it very seriously.”

Indeed, a total of just four criminal homicides were reported in 2025 and this was well below the national average per capita, which is between 25 and 70 for counties of populations between 500,000 and 1 million.

“The police all across the county work hard on violent crime. I think that’s paying off, I think immigration enforcement at the federal level also matters, I think that makes a difference. So I think it’s a number of different things are coming together,” added the commissioner.

“I would attribute a lot of our success in, the lowering of those statistics to be our community partnerships,”

The strength of these community partnerships was evident during the recent raid at Avenue J-2, which resulted in a successful operation in the end.
